Abstract

We describe a new technology for the fabrication of polydimethylsiloxane (PDMS) optical fibers and PDMS fiber structures, based on fiber drawing from partially cured PDMS. This technology allows the fabrication of PDMS fibers in a wide range of diameters and different lengths. We demonstrate the potential of such prepared PDMS optical fibers on a variety of typical and unconventional fiber structures such as multimode optical fibers, looped and twisted fibers, and optical fiber couplers.
